Output c81d72f92990a0d65ab7a579dd23a82334dd5ab2cb8d3cb238443f5fcb5893a6:17

value
237868696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f84001506b4d90d93ebb42eda41e2eebe5bab385 OP_EQUALVERIFY OP_CHECKSIG
address
1PddFjFvLXcMVK9VDrchKQpR7DuvSKhuFK
transaction
c81d72f92990a0d65ab7a579dd23a82334dd5ab2cb8d3cb238443f5fcb5893a6
spent
true